Output 5fbc86d7131085a3b452bc35109fa5c5b11a90cd033090033d955783fbca8760:24

value
27968097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d343bf7aec812b63389c60bf9a09a024beb763e4 OP_EQUAL
address
MTADy7ngak1TTZguEofv4CUt7QJPK6UQRD
transaction
5fbc86d7131085a3b452bc35109fa5c5b11a90cd033090033d955783fbca8760
spent
true